There is no scientific reason why their relationship would be a problem. Since they are not blood related, they would not create children at higher risk of genetic disorders. Also, science can change in fantasy worlds. However, what people find "icky" is usually not based on scientific, rational thought. The icky feeling is usually a reflex, a thoughtless action. There is also an issue with power dynamics within the relationship. So the trouble here is that they may not enter the relationship at an even level. If the power dynamics are not equal, one becomes the master and the other becomes their servant. That may lead to abuse. In this story, a parent and child start a relationship. Unless the child has lived alone for some time, the child is dependent on the parent. That means that the parent has the power. With power, the parent can make demands. This parent may never be abusive, but in real life, abuse is common. |
